What to Expect During Your Rental

When you arrive at the meeting point at 2 Rue Halévy, you’ll be briefed on how to operate the scooter. Expect a quick safety overview and instructions about the different speeds—likely three—that you can choose from. Once you’re comfortable, you’ll be free to explore.
The self-guided tour allows you to design your own route. Many visitors love zipping along the Promenade des Anglais, where stunning views of the sea make for a memorable ride. Climbing up to Castle Hill is another popular stop, providing panoramic views over Nice, which you can reach easily on the scooter. The Old Town is a must-see, with its lively markets, narrow streets, and vibrant atmosphere, perfect for a leisurely cruise.

Practical Tips for Your Scooter Adventure
- Plan your route ahead: Think about key spots you want to visit, like Castle Hill, Old Town, or the Promenade.
- Wear comfortable clothing and closed shoes: Safety and comfort go hand-in-hand.
- Check the scooter before riding: Make sure it’s in good condition and that you understand the controls.
- Start early or late in the day: Nice’s daytime crowds can be busy, and riding during less crowded times makes for a more relaxed experience.
- Respect local traffic laws and pedestrian zones: Scooters are fun, but safety always comes first.

FAQ

Is the scooter rental suitable for all ages?
Not quite. The minimum age for participants is 14, so younger children won’t be able to join. This makes it more suitable for teens and adults.
Can I rent the scooter for more than an hour?
Yes, you can rent it for anywhere from two hours up to a full week, so you can customize your sightseeing schedule.
What’s included in the price?
The rental fee covers the use of the scooter, which is fully charged. You’ll receive a brief safety overview and instructions to make your ride smooth.
Is the activity private?
Yes, only your group participates, ensuring a personalized experience without strangers in your way.
How do I find the meeting point?
The activity starts at 2 Rue Halévy, which is conveniently located near public transportation options in Nice.
Are there any restrictions I should be aware of?
The activity is not accessible for those with reduced mobility, and riders must be comfortable operating the scooter.
What are the reviews saying?
All reviews are positive, with travelers praising the scooters’ condition, the helpful staff, and the ease of reaching key sights like Castle Hill.
What’s the cancellation policy?
You can cancel for free up to 24 hours before the scheduled start, getting a full refund if you change your mind.
Is this a guided tour?
No, it’s a self-guided experience, giving you the freedom to explore at your own pace.
